C49H34N2

Base Information
  • Chemical Name:C49H34N2
  • CAS No.:1388113-92-5
  • Molecular Formula:C49H34N2
  • Molecular Weight:650.822

synthetic route:
Guidance literature:
With copper(l) iodide; tetrakis(triphenylphosphine) palladium(0); diisopropylamine; In toluene; at 80 ℃; Inert atmosphere;
DOI:10.1021/ol3017353
Guidance literature:
Multi-step reaction with 2 steps
1: copper(l) iodide; tetrakis(triphenylphosphine) palladium(0); diisopropylamine / toluene / 50 °C / Inert atmosphere
2: copper(l) iodide; tetrakis(triphenylphosphine) palladium(0); diisopropylamine / toluene / 80 °C / Inert atmosphere
With copper(l) iodide; tetrakis(triphenylphosphine) palladium(0); diisopropylamine; In toluene; 1: Sonogashira coupling / 2: Sonogashira coupling;
DOI:10.1021/ol3017353
Guidance literature:
Multi-step reaction with 3 steps
1: copper(l) iodide; tetrakis(triphenylphosphine) palladium(0); diisopropylamine / toluene / 20 °C / Inert atmosphere
2: water; potassium carbonate / tetrahydrofuran; methanol / 2 h / 20 °C / Inert atmosphere
3: copper(l) iodide; tetrakis(triphenylphosphine) palladium(0); diisopropylamine / toluene / 80 °C / Inert atmosphere
With copper(l) iodide; tetrakis(triphenylphosphine) palladium(0); water; potassium carbonate; diisopropylamine; In tetrahydrofuran; methanol; toluene; 1: Sonogashira coupling / 3: Sonogashira coupling;
DOI:10.1021/ol3017353
